A Thirty Three Piece Piero Benzoni Green Onyx and Marble Silver-Plated and Gilt Bronze Chess Set, Italy, 60-70 years of the 20th century. Chess set made by the prestigious goldsmith Piero Benzoni. The figures depict the Mongol Invasion of Europe. The Western Campaign lasted from 1236 to 1242. Batu led the troops, Subotai (called one of the four Genghis's fiercest dogs) was his main counselor.. Piero Benzoni was born near Melegnano, a small town in Lombardy, south of Milan. At the age of 14, he began his apprenticeship in silversmith workshops. In 1966, he founded his own company in Melegnano. In 1976, Benzoni started a new line he called "Art Bronzes" making beautiful models of chess sets in antique costumes, representing different historical periods. Over the decades, several chess sets produced by Benzoni himself ended up in the homes of the wealthier classes. One of his clients was Michael Jackson, who had a Benzoni chess set in his mansion.
